
hmem — Setup
from hmem (persistent agent memory)10
Interactive installer and setup guide for hmem (persistent memory MCP server); automates .mcp.json config, memory dir, and adds agent hooks for Claude Code, Gem
What it does
This skill provides an interactive installer (hmem init) and manual setup instructions to install and configure hmem — a persistent-memory MCP server that integrates with agent tools (Claude Code, Gemini CLI, Cursor, OpenCode). It automates dependency installation, writes .mcp.json entries, creates a memory directory and default hmem.config.json, and deploys helper skill files and Claude hooks so agents can read and write long-term memory.
When to use it
Use this skill when you want to add persistent, structured memory to your AI agent workflow. It's appropriate during initial environment setup for a developer machine or CI environment, when migrating memory across machines, or when you need consistent hook-based checkpointing and exchange logging for agent sessions.
What's included
- Scripts: none in this SKILL.md package (has_scripts=false).
- References: none bundled.
- Instructions: step-by-step commands for
hmem init, a non-interactive flag for CI, manual fallback steps (clone, build, configure.mcp.json), and a configuration reference for tuning memory behaviour and bulk-read selection. The SKILL.md also documents Claude-specific hook scripts and their behavior (UserPromptSubmit, Stop, SessionStart) and troubleshooting tips.
Compatible agents
Inferred compatible tools: Claude Code, Gemini CLI, Cursor, OpenCode, Windsurf. The skill explicitly documents Claude Code hooks and mentions other CLI tools in its compatibility list.
Tags
Information
- Repository
- hmem (persistent agent memory)
- Stars
- 10
- Installs
- 0